NMMC receives first shipment of COVID vaccine Tuesday

NMMC receives first shipment of COVID vaccine Tuesday Updated - The hospital in Tupelo received its first batch of the vaccine Tuesday afternoon. Posted: Dec 15, 2020 3:22 PM Updated: Dec 15, 2020 6:56 PM Posted By: Chelsea Brown, Zac Carlisle TUPELO, Miss. (WTVA) - The North Mississippi Medical Center (NMMC) in Tupelo received its first shipment of the COVID-19 vaccine Tuesday. Members of the National Guard helped escort the box containing the vaccine, and doctors and hospital leadership escorted the box inside the hospital. National Guard members and Dr. Wes Pitts receiving the shipment on Dec. 15, 2020. NMMC President David Wilson (left), Director of Pharmacy Wes Pitts (center), North Mississippi Health Services president & CEO Shane Spees (right) escorting the vaccine inside the hospital in Tupelo.
